Analog Devices (NASDAQ: ADI) leads in crafting high-performance analog, mixed-signal, and digital signal processing integrated circuits. For decades, they've tackled signal processing challenges across global electronics. With over 100,000 clients, their products convert real-world phenomena into electrical signals. Merged with Maxim Integrated, they offer top-tier mixed-signal and power management technologies, solving complex problems from DC to 100 GHz and sensor to cloud.

The ADuM260N/ADuM261N/ADuM262N/ADuM263N1 are6-channel digital isolators based on Analog Devices, Inc., iCoupler®technology. Combining high speed, complementary metal-oxidesemiconductor (CMOS) and monolithic air core transformertechnology, these isolation components provide outstandingperformance characteristics superior to alternatives such asoptocoupler devices and other integrated couplers. The maxi-mum propagation delay is 13 ns with a pulse width distortion ofless than 4.5 ns at 5 V operation. Channel to channel matchingof propagation delay is tight at 4.0 ns maximum.The ADuM260N/ADuM261N/ADuM262N/ADuM263N datachannels are independent and are available in a variety ofconfigurations with a withstand voltage rating of 5.0 kV rms(see the Ordering Guide). The devices operate with the supplyvoltage on either side ranging from 1.7 V to 5.5 V, providingcompatibility with lower voltage systems as well as enablingvoltage translation functionality across the isolation barrier.Unlike other optocoupler alternatives, dc correctness is ensuredin the absence of input logic transitions. Two different fail-safeoptions are available by which the outputs transition to a predeter-mined state when the input power supply is not applied.
